英法德意等欧洲七国领导人发布联合声明:格陵兰岛属于其人民 格陵兰岛位于北美洲东北部,是世界第一大岛。该岛是丹麦自治领地,有高度自治权,国防和外交事务 由丹麦政府掌管。美国目前在格陵兰岛有一个军事基地。特朗普去年上任以来多次扬言要得到格陵兰 岛,并声称不排除动用武力的可能性。 环球网版权所有。未经许可,请勿转载使用。 来源:环球网/闫珮云 据英国天空新闻网、爱尔兰广播电视台当地时间6日报道,法国、德国、英国、意大利、波兰、西班牙 和丹麦的领导人发表联合声明,称格陵兰岛属于其人民。 格陵 兰岛首府努克 资料图 图源:外媒 七国领导人在声明中称,北极安全仍然是欧洲的关键优先事务,对国际安全和跨大西洋安全至关重要, 必须通过与包括美国在内的北约盟国共同努力,通过维护《联合国宪章》的各项原则来实现,包括主 权、领土完整和边界不可侵犯。"这些都是普遍适用的原则,我们将继续捍卫它们。"声明说。 "格陵兰岛属于其人民。有关丹麦和格陵兰岛的事务,只能由丹麦和格陵兰岛自行决定。"声明称。 美国总统特朗普4日接受美国《大西洋》月刊电话采访时称,委内瑞拉可能不会是美国干预的最后一个 国家,并称"我们绝对需要格陵兰岛"。丹麦首相弗雷泽 ...
